Estate planning means the process of arranging for the management and distribution of your assets after death. This typically involves drafting wills, trusts, and power of attorney documents. An estate planning lawyer guarantees that your wishes are legally documented and complies with state laws.
You might want to hire an estate planning lawyer when you have assets such as property, investments, or dependents. Conversely, if you have minimal assets and are single, you may not need extensive legal help.

Common tools in estate planning include irrevocable trusts, which assist in avoiding probate. Techniques like tax planning may also be employed to minimize tax liabilities. Lawyers often use software like WealthCounsel or Gentreo to streamline document preparation.
The cost of hiring an estate planning lawyer varies widely based on experience and location. You might expect between $1,000 and $3,500 for a basic estate plan. More complex plans may cost upwards of $5,000. Factors that affect pricing include the lawyer's expertise, the intricacies of your estate, and whether additional services like tax advice are needed.
Generally, a flat fee is common for basic estate planning, while hourly rates may apply for more complicated cases, often ranging $150 to $500 per hour.
